Why do I need this stylesheet? ------------------------------ I have many publications whose TOCs - just the plain, ASCII text of the headings, without any markup - is over a megabyte. I want to present these publications on a website, with the TOC displayed as an expandable nested list, similar to the Contents pane in the Microsoft HTML Help (.chm) viewer. I already do this on an intranet site, using the HTML Help ActiveX control in an HTML frameset to display the .hhc, but the size of these TOCs makes this method impractical over a slower Web connection. The TOCs are simply too large to send over the Web in one chunk. For nearly two years, I've wanted to emulate the Microsoft Developer Network (MSDN) Library website (http://www.msdn.microsoft.com/library/default.asp), which loads only the root TOC nodes by default, and thereafter loads TOC nodes "on demand", when the user clicks an expandable node. As far as I can tell, by rummaging around the site's source files, clicking an expandable TOC node invokes an Internet Explorer-specific behavior (.htc) that dynamically loads a TOC subtree, and inserts that subtree into the existing displayed TOC. (If you use a browser other than IE - such as Netscape - then the TOC is not quite as smart as this.) But I've never found the time to "re-engineer" this. Today, I stumbled across Aurigma Deep Tree (see the link at the top of this email), which not only does most of what the MSDN Library website TOC does, but it's cross-browser compatible, too. (Unfortunately, unlike the MSDN Library TOC, the Aurigma solution is frame-based, and doesn't highlight the current topic in the TOC, or synchronize the TOC with the topic.) With Aurigma Deep Tree, each TOC subtree is defined in a separate HTML file, and the nodes in each subtree are defined in those files as JavaScript array elements. A "folder" TOC node (that is, a node that contains a subtree of child nodes) looks like this: oNodes[1] = new node("Services", null , "folder", "main", "TOC/Services.htm"); The node displayed as "Services" is an empty folder; "null" indicates that it is not linked to an HTML topic (but if it did, it would be displayed in the frame called "main"). When you click the node, it expands to show the subtree defined in TOC/Services.htm. An item (or, if you like, "leaf") node looks like this: oNodes[2] = new node("Support", "Support.htm", "item", "main"); My thoughts so far ------------------ First, I'd planned to use the W3C Tidy tool to convert the .hhc into XHTML, so that it can be transformed by an XSLT stylesheet. An .hhc is essentially just an HTML document containing nested <ul> lists, where each TOC node is defined inside an <li> element, like this: <li> <object type="text/sitemap"> <param name="Name" value="Topic heading"/> <param name="Local" value="topic.htm"/> <param name="ImageNumber" value="11"/> </object> </li> The <param> elements and <li> elements aren't necessarily closed/well-formed in a .hhc, hence the need for Tidy... and TOC nodes can be "empty": they don't necessarily contain a <param name="local"> elements. Then I'd write an XSLT template that would, say, iterate (for-each) over the <li> elements inside an <ul>, build the necessary oNode[x] assignments, and save them as a TOC/something_or_other.htm file, starting with TOC/Root.htm (as required by the default Aurigma JavaScript).
